Sound Point Meridian...
NYSE:SPMC
$ 8,88
$0,00 (0,00%)
8,88 $
$0,00 (0,00%)
End-of-day quote: 03/20/2026
New Note

New Note

Notes

You have not yet created any notes for this stock.

×